
Wisconsin Delivers a Shutout to The Bandits
Published on May 8, 2011 under Midwest League (MWL1)
Wisconsin Timber Rattlers News Release
GRAND CHUTE, WI - Less than 24 hours after the Quad Cities River Bandits shutout the Wisconsin Timber Rattlers, three Rattlers pitchers combined on a 4-hit shutout of the Bandits. Wisconsin beat Quad Cities 3-0 on Sunday afternoon at Time Warner Cable Field. Tyler Thornburg tossed six scoreless frames and struck out eight for his second win of the season. Eric Marzec and Greg Holle pitched the final three frames to close out the victory.
All the offense Wisconsin (12-15) needed came in the third inning. Reggie Keen tripled with one out. An RBI grounder by Nick Shaw drove Keen home for a 1-0 lead.
Cody Hawn homered, his second of the season, to lead off the Rattlers fourth inning. Later in the frame, Tyler Roberts drove in the third run of the game with a sacrifice fly and Wisconsin was up 3-0.
Quad Cities (14-16) got a double from Greg Garcia to start the game and a two out single from Cody Stanley in the first inning. But, Thornburg did not allow a River Bandit past second base. Thornburg walked two, hit a batter, and gave up just one more hit in the game.
Marzec worked around a walk in the seventh and a hit in the eighth to keep the River Bandits off the scoreboard.
Then, Holle pitched a perfect ninth for his fifth save in five attempts this season.
The final game of the series between the Rattlers and River Bandits is Monday evening at Time Warner Cable Field. Matt Miller (1-3, 4.34) is the scheduled starting pitcher for Wisconsin. Trevor Rosenthal (1-3, 3.00) gets the start for Quad Cities. Game time is 6:35pm.
